'I’d be pulling my hair out': Andy Cole explains why Antony is hard to play with for strikers

"If I was a striker in this Manchester United team and saw Antony was playing on the right wing, I’d be pulling my hair out because I know that I will never get a cross my way on his weak right foot," former Man United striker Andy Cole told King Casino Bonus.

"If I was making a run into the box, I would not expect anything because he always chops back on to his left foot.

"The game has changed now and what managers want from wingers is different."

In his first season at Man United, Antony has provided only one assist in the FA Cup win over Reading which may prove Cole's point.

He has been on the scoresheet more often, finding the target six times across all competition - not too bad, although a lot more will be expected from him in the next season.
